    Abstract: A nonaqueous electrolyte secondary battery having an electrode group in which a positive electrode plate containing a positive electrode active material and a negative electrode plate containing a negative electrode active material are wound with a separator there between. The positive electrode active material uses a lithium transition metal oxide represented by the formula LiaNixM1-xO2 (0.9?a?1.2, 0.8?x<1, and M is at least one element of Co, Mn, and Al). The positive electrode plate is provided with a current-collecting tab placed in a position that is 200 mm or more apart from the winding start of the positive electrode plate. The separator has an MD direction tensile strength (SMD)-to-TD direction tensile strength (STD) ratio (SMD/STD) of from 0.72 to 1.37 and an MD direction tensile elongation (EMD)-to-TD direction tensile elongation (ETD) ratio (EMD/ETD) of from 0.34 to 1.29.

    Abstract: A non-aqueous electrolyte secondary battery system includes a non-aqueous electrolyte secondary battery and a charging control system which has a function of detecting the voltage of the non-aqueous electrolyte secondary battery and disconnecting a charging circuit. The non-aqueous electrolytic solution contains a non-aqueous solvent having a viscosity of 0.6 cP or less at 25° C. in an amount of 35 to 80 vol % inclusive as a non-aqueous solvent and also contains hexamethylene diisocyanate, and the charging control system stops charging when the potential of the positive electrode of the non-aqueous electrolyte secondary battery is 4.35 to 4.6 V inclusive based on lithium. Thus the non-aqueous electrolyte secondary battery system equipped with the non-aqueous electrolyte secondary battery having high charging potential and excellent high-temperature cycling characteristics can be provided.

    Abstract: A manufacturing method for an ink jet recording head. The method includes the steps of preparing a recording element substrate, preparing an electric wiring member, preparing a sealing material discharging member, and applying a sealing material. The ink jet recording head is constructed to provide a first gap between a recording element substrate and an inner edge of a hole. The first gap is larger than a second gap between the recording element substrate and an opposite inner edge of the hole measured along the same line. The sealing material is applied while moving the sealing material discharging member, along the line, from a portion of an electric wiring member adjacent to the first gap, across the first gap, across the electrical connection portions, across the second gap, to a portion of the electric wiring member adjacent to the second gap.
